Symantec Receives Notification of Deficiency from Nasdaq Related to Delayed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q


Symantec (News - Alert) Corp. (NASDAQ: SYMC) received on August 10, 2018 a standard notice from Nasdaq stating that, as a result of not having timely filed its quarterly report on Form 10-Q for the quarterly period ended June 29, 2018, Symantec is not in compliance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5250(c)(1), which requires timely filing of periodic financial reports with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

The Nasdaq notice has no immediate effect on the listing or trading of Symantec's common stock on the Nasdaq Global Select Market. As previously announced, Symantec received a notice of non-compliance from Nasdaq on May 31, 2018 due to delay in the filing of Symantec's annual report on Form 10-K for the fiscal year ended March 30, 2018 (the "Form 10-K"). Under Nasdaq's listing rules, Symantec was permitted to submit to Nasdaq a plan to regain compliance with the Nasdaq Listing Rules. Symantec previously submitted such a plan to the Nasdaq Staff, and Nasdaq has granted Symantec until November 26, 2018 to regain compliance.
